A particle moves along $x$-axis obeying the equation $x=t(t-1)(t-2)$, where $x$ (in metres) is the position of the particle at any time $t$ (in seconds). The displacement when the velocity of the particle is zero, is
(a) $-\frac{2}{3 \sqrt{3}} m, \frac{2}{3 \sqrt{3}} m$
(b) $-\frac{5}{3 \sqrt{3}} m, \frac{5}{3 \sqrt{3}} m$
(c) $-3 m , 3 m$
(d) $-5 m , 5 m$
